Transaction 35540859ee73c0c70c96f246539c321f44dbd880d3e057c41fdbd62f62f58785
1 Input
2 Outputs
- 35540859ee73c0c70c96f246539c321f44dbd880d3e057c41fdbd62f62f58785:0
- 35540859ee73c0c70c96f246539c321f44dbd880d3e057c41fdbd62f62f58785:1
value 8056787
address 35SJ9LcRitPmiVDz4XwydB5FQjgRYtNNHP
value 378747075
address 1FoesHs5Z7snHy3WYuk4Euh7NxxKWNtgyx